Textile designer and illustrator Balakrishna Madana has launched his first textile collection under the name Krishna Madana. Brought up in a south Indian village he was influenced by the bright colour and beautiful patterns of the silks and cottons being produced and sold in the area. Madana was educated in India and the UK where he developed his passion for fabric design. His first collection of silk scarves, cushions and embroidered wall art is inspired by Mughal architecture and jewellery and comprises bold colours and shapes.
